Standing Before the King: Glory on the New Year

GLORY TO THE KING!!
The pasuk says in this week’s parasha, “אתם נצבים היום כולכם – you are all standing here today.” Chazal tell us the word “היום-today” is also a reference to the day of Rosh Hashanah. Rashi says the Jewish People’s faces had turned pale after hearing about the ill effects of their sins, and Moshe came to give them chizuk, telling them, You’re still standing here. You could make teshuva. You could change. You can be better.
Rosh Hashanah is a glorious time, but we have to do our part. It’s not about making just one small kabbalah and moving on with life as usual. It’s a time to think big.
Before we ask for blessings for the new year, we must look back and thank Hashem for everything He gave us this past year. And if there are things that a person wanted that he didn’t get or the person feels, in general, like he’s lacking, if he could thank Hashem for the year he was given, the zechut is enormous.
May we be zocheh to have a year that brings glory to the Melech and may we be zocheh to a year of berachot, refuot and yeshuot and see the coming of the Mashiach. AMEN!!!
